FRANKFURT -- Franz Beckenbauer says it was his mistake to make a payment to FIFA in return for a financial grant to the Germany's 2006 World Cup organizing committee.

In a brief statement published by German media late Monday, Beckenbauer gave little details about the case that has shaken German football.

He reiterated his denial from last week that there was no vote buying before Germany won the bid to stage the World Cup.

Beckenbauer said that "in hindsight" FIFA's request for a payment in return for a grant should have been rejected.

As president of the organizing committee, Beckenbauer said, "I take responsibility for this mistake."

Der Spiegel weekly has alleged that the organizing committee used a slush fund to buy votes for the successful bid.
